Did you know?
WebBiting is an instinctive behavior often seen in infants, toddlers, and 2-year olds. They bite in order to cope with a challenge or fulfill a need. Gaining self-control and developing problem-solving skills supports a child outgrowing the response of biting. It is unusual for a preschool age (3-5 year old) child to continue to bite.
